O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 2322|回复: 5

大家计数都用什么存储芯片啊?因为我一天要计数1万个左右,普通的EEPROM估计受不了啊?有没有好的方法啊?

[复制链接]

36

主题

75

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
424
金钱
424
注册时间
2015-12-16
在线时间
112 小时
发表于 2020-3-16 14:29:44 | 显示全部楼层 |阅读模式
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

14

主题

141

帖子

1

精华

金牌会员

Rank: 6Rank: 6

积分
1124
金钱
1124
注册时间
2015-12-20
在线时间
119 小时
发表于 2020-3-16 14:52:13 | 显示全部楼层
1、不存在同一位置,轮着来存2、计数10个才存一次
回复

使用道具 举报

7

主题

59

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1159
金钱
1159
注册时间
2018-5-30
在线时间
151 小时
发表于 2020-3-16 14:58:37 | 显示全部楼层
备份寄存器是42 个 16 位的寄存器( 战舰开发板就是大容量的 ),可用来存储 84 个字节的用户应用程序数据。他们处在备份域里,当 VDD 电源被切断,他们仍然由 VBAT 维持供电。即使系统在待机模式下被唤醒,或系统复位或电源复位时,他们也不会被复位。
我们一般用BKP 来存储 RTC 的校验值或者记录一些重要的数据,相当于一个 EEPROM,不过这个EEPROM 并不是真正的 EEPROM ,而是需要电池来维持它的数据。关于 BKP 的详细介绍请看《 STM32 参考手册》的第 47 页, 5.1 一节。
备份寄存器中,RTC用了几个,还有几个没使用到,你可以当做EEPROM使用,不过要加电池。
回复

使用道具 举报

36

主题

75

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
424
金钱
424
注册时间
2015-12-16
在线时间
112 小时
 楼主| 发表于 2020-3-16 15:11:32 | 显示全部楼层
大个之 发表于 2020-3-16 14:58
备份寄存器是42 个 16 位的寄存器( 战舰开发板就是大容量的 ),可用来存储 84 个字节的用户应用程序数据 ...

不过这个EEPROM也是有寿命限制的 ,写多了也会坏掉
人的一生总得有个目标!
回复

使用道具 举报

7

主题

59

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1159
金钱
1159
注册时间
2018-5-30
在线时间
151 小时
发表于 2020-3-16 15:59:36 | 显示全部楼层
小熊snail 发表于 2020-3-16 15:11
不过这个EEPROM也是有寿命限制的 ,写多了也会坏掉

这不是EEPROM,是RAM,不会坏的。具体怎么用,你找下资料,我没用过。
回复

使用道具 举报

0

主题

114

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
2583
金钱
2583
注册时间
2019-10-18
在线时间
414 小时
发表于 2020-3-16 16:59:36 | 显示全部楼层
一个是大点容量的芯片不同地址轮着写,一个eeprom不行换个nandflsh.一个是换个带后备电源的ram.类似与时钟芯片那种带小电池的
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-5-22 18:27

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表